Green Supply Chains

The ” Green Supply Chain ” project consortium has advanced its studies into short-term solutions for the energy transition in ports and logistics chains.

In BrestPort, the scope of studies covers in particular the implantation of a LNG production, storage and distribution plant with the just started “risk assessment step”. LNG and bio-LNG enable reducing 60% of Sox and 20% of Co2. It is considered as one transition step by shipping companies. Feasibility conditions will be set out under four months.
